Region 5, District 8: Gov. JB Pritzker joined the departments of transportation in Illinois and Missouri on June 13 to celebrate the start of construction on the new Interstate 270 Chain of Rocks Bridge over the Mississippi River in the Metro East. The project, funded by Rebuild Illinois, is part of a combined $531.6 million investment to improve one of the country's critical freight corridors.
The I-270 loop connects many of the region's warehouses and distribution parks, ports, airports, and rail yards on both sides of the Mississippi River. Nearly 70% of the region's industrial tenants occupying large warehouse space in excess of 500,000 square feet are within ten minutes of the interstate.
The $496.2 million joint IDOT-MoDOT project will replace the existing 57-year-old bridge with two structures that have wider shoulders that can accommodate the eventual expansion of I-270 to three lanes in each direction.
